Subject: [PATCH 1/4] UBI: Introduce ubi_schedule_fm_work()

Wrap the fastmap work scheduling code into a new function
such that it can be reused.

Signed-off-by: Richard Weinberger <richard@nod.at>
---
 drivers/mtd/ubi/fastmap-wl.c |  5 +----
 drivers/mtd/ubi/ubi.h        | 12 ++++++++++++
 2 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/mtd/ubi/fastmap-wl.c b/drivers/mtd/ubi/fastmap-wl.c
index b2a6653..fc0e2ff 100644
--- a/drivers/mtd/ubi/fastmap-wl.c
+++ b/drivers/mtd/ubi/fastmap-wl.c
@@ -237,10 +237,7 @@ static struct ubi_wl_entry *get_peb_for_wl(struct ubi_device *ubi)
 		/* We cannot update the fastmap here because this
 		 * function is called in atomic context.
 		 * Let's fail here and refill/update it as soon as possible. */
-		if (!ubi->fm_work_scheduled) {
-			ubi->fm_work_scheduled = 1;
-			schedule_work(&ubi->fm_work);
-		}
+		ubi_schedule_fm_work(ubi);
 		return NULL;
 	}
 
diff --git a/drivers/mtd/ubi/ubi.h b/drivers/mtd/ubi/ubi.h
index 11f8fb0..cb3dcd0 100644
--- a/drivers/mtd/ubi/ubi.h
+++ b/drivers/mtd/ubi/ubi.h
@@ -881,8 +881,20 @@ size_t ubi_calc_fm_size(struct ubi_device *ubi);
 int ubi_update_fastmap(struct ubi_device *ubi);
 int ubi_scan_fastmap(struct ubi_device *ubi, struct ubi_attach_info *ai,
 		     int fm_anchor);
+/**
+ * ubi_schedule_fm_work - Schedule UBI fastmap work
+ * @ubi: UBI device description object
+ */
+static inline void ubi_schedule_fm_work(struct ubi_device *ubi)
+{
+	if (!ubi->fm_work_scheduled) {
+		ubi->fm_work_scheduled = 1;
+		schedule_work(&ubi->fm_work);
+	}
+}
 #else
 static inline int ubi_update_fastmap(struct ubi_device *ubi) { return 0; }
+static inline void ubi_schedule_fm_work(struct ubi_device *ubi) { }
 #endif
 
 /* block.c */
